Take a pair of six-sided dice. You know, the ones with the pips on them. Take a sharpie. Pay attention now, you're going to potentially ruin your dice... connect the dots on the 6 to turn it into a big blocky boxy zero.
okay, you could also buy dice like that, but that doesn't make use of your monopoly dice from that set your kids ruined, right?
Now you can roll these special 2d6 and they will produce a nice result from 0-10 with a strong probability peak at 5. Now you can have an RPG that uses intuitive numbering 1-10 and you have to roll under to succeed. "On a scale from 1-10, how strong is my character?" Intuitive, right? Random game mechanic musing
